It depends if you need an amp or not.

By the way I can't see any difference between running through and integrated amp, or active speakers. As most actives will have a pre-amp/power amp section. (Remember not to buy a set that use a DAC to convert music digitally to second speaker.

The difference is mostly that the active speakers have electronic crossovers which means that the individual amplifiers in them are connected direct to the drivers without any of the passive crossover components in the signal path. This can make a big improvement to the sound. For instance I have heard the identical passive and active versions of the ATC 40 Mk2 speakers (in other words everything is the same except that one is passive and the other is active) and the differences are so big that you would think it is a completely different speaker. It is even possible that the advantages of using TT2 direct to passive speakers is outweighed by taking a different Chord DAC direct to active speakers..
